About Median Madness

Houston City Council Member Fred Flickinger began Median Madness in 2024. Since then hundreds of volunteers have made a visible difference in their community by trimming back vines and underbrush that were spilling out into major traffic arteries.

This weekend, an army of volunteers for Round 7 of Median Madness will tackle another sore point near the entrance to Trailwood Village.

A Thank You to Sponsors

This event is supported by the Trailwood Village Community Association, the Department of Neighborhoods Matching Grant Program, the Houston Parks and Recreation Department, Houston Public Works, HPD, Trees for Kingwood, the Houston Tool Bank, H‑E‑B, and Chick‑fil‑A.

Trees for Kingwood is working with the Texas A&M Forest Service to plan improvements to Kingwood’s medians. They include replacing invasive species with native species to make growth in the medians more sustainable and maintainable. The invasive species have totally crowded out native species in numerous places.
